Understanding the Aviator Game Mechanic
The core concept of the aviator game hinges on observing an aircraft taking off. As the aircraft ascends, a multiplier increases, representing the potential winnings. Players must decide when to ‘cash out’ before the aircraft flies away, as cashing out at the right moment secures their winnings multiplied by the current coefficient. Timing is crucial – waiting too long risks losing the bet if the aircraft disappears from view.
This simple premise belies a level of strategic depth. Successful play requires a balance between ambition and caution, anticipating when the multiplier will peak and when it’s time to secure profits. Understanding Risk Management
Risk management is paramount when engaging in any casino game, and the aviator game is no exception. An effective risk management strategy involves setting clear limits on both potential losses and desired profits. Determine a maximum bet amount and stick to it, regardless of the predictor’s suggestions. Implementing a stop-loss order, automatically exiting a round after a certain loss threshold is met, can also help protect your capital. Similarly, establish a profit target and cash out when it’s reached, resisting the temptation to chase ever-larger multipliers. It’s also vital to realistically assess your risk tolerance; what level of loss are you comfortable with?
An ‘aviator predictor’ can be particularly useful here, helping you assess the probability of success based on historical data and current market conditions. However, remember that probabilities represent long-term trends and don’t guarantee results in any individual round. It is also important to remember that the emotional aspect of gambling can substantially impact your decision making. A disciplined approach informed by logical analysis, rather than impulsive reactions, is vital for consistent results.
